- Aleksandr Karin was born on April 28, 1952 in Prokopievsk, Kemerovskaya oblast, USSR. He was an actor, known for Lermontov (1986), Yaroslav Mudry (1982) and Osobyy sluchay (1983). He died on March 13, 2026 in France.
- Soviet and Russian actor, stuntman and stunt director.
- In the late 1980s, Karin graduated from the Higher Courses of Directors and Screenwriters of the State Cinema of the USSR.
- He spent his childhood and youth in Volgograd.
- In 1977, he graduated from the Mikhail Shchepkin Higher Theater School. After graduation, he worked in the theater, including on the stage of the Theater of Miniatures. Karin came to the cinema in the late 1970s.
- In the early 1970s, he served in the army in Germany.
